Premium Only Content

STM32 OLED Tutorial | SSD1306 Display with I2C (Text + Graphics)
Learn how to interface the SSD1306 OLED display with an STM32 microcontroller using the I2C protocol, STM32CubeMX, and HAL libraries. In this step-by-step tutorial, you'll see how to configure I2C in CubeMX, write HAL-based code, and display text and bitmaps on a 128x64 OLED screen. This guide is perfect for beginners and embedded developers working on real-time display projects with STM32.
📌 Covered in this video:
- Wiring the OLED to STM32 (I2C)
- CubeMX I2C and GPIO setup
- HAL-based SSD1306 initialization
- Displaying text and images on OLED
✅ Tested on STM32F103 (Blue Pill), but works with other STM32 MCUs.
📁 Source Code + Tutorial:
👉 https://controllerstech.com/oled-display-using-i2c-stm32/
STM32 Playlist : https://www.youtube.com/playlist?list=PLfIJKC1ud8gga7xeUUJ-bRUbeChfTOOBd
🔔 Don’t forget to subscribe for more STM32 tutorials!
#STM32 #OLED #SSD1306 #CubeMX #I2C
-
LIVE
Steven Crowder
1 hour ago🔴 They Are Lying Because They Are Losing: ICE Shooter, White People, & ... Bees?
70,993 watching -
LIVE
The Rubin Report
35 minutes agoGavin Newsom Humiliates Himself on Colbert by Saying This Live On-Air
1,730 watching -
LIVE
Right Side Broadcasting Network
1 hour agoLIVE: President Trump Greets Turkey’s President Erdogan - 9/25/25
1,166 watching -
LIVE
Benny Johnson
1 hour agoPANIC: James Comey Indictment IMMINENT, Faces PRISON | Letitia James, John Bolton Next, Trump CURSE
6,823 watching -
VINCE
2 hours agoHow Many More Tragedies Before A Change Is Made? | Episode 133 - 09/25/25
73.4K47 -
LIVE
LFA TV
17 hours agoBREAKING NEWS ALL DAY! | THURSDAY 9/25/25
4,467 watching -
DVR
theoriginalmarkz
1 hour agoCoffee with MarkZ. 09/25/2025
2.08K -
LIVE
Badlands Media
6 hours agoBadlands Daily: September 25, 2025
4,056 watching -
LIVE
The Big Mig™
2 hours agoEpstein Was CIA & Who Is Trump Protecting?
5,970 watching -
LIVE
Chad Prather
44 minutes agoChristian Youth Coach SHOT In Texas While Praying W/ Team! + Megyn Kelly DESTROYS Libs On TPUSA Tour
480 watching